Course objectives:
|
To introduce students with management principle of the power industry in market conditions. To understand the electricity specialities against other sorts of goods in the delivering systems from supply cycles to consumers. To determine the electricity price on the base of costs and revenues flows in electrical systems. To learn the energy balances of the systems, suplly systems and power consumption.

Content
|
The subject deals with the principles of power systems management and marketing, especially in electric power systems. The classification of electric power systems costs is discussed and the electricity price is defined. Next, the function and problematic of the transmission power network in market conditions and on consumption side management is discussed.
Lecture schedule: 1. Introduction to the subject, the definition of basic terms - electric power network, marketing, management. 2. Balance of the power system networks and their parameters. 3. Specialties of power networks, selling amount determination. 4. Classification of the costs flow in electric power networks - segmentation. 5. Electricity power price determination, market with it and its operation. 6. Electricity tariffs 7. Account deviation among suppliers and customers. 8. Transmission power network role in power network. 9. Determination of the power system services costs 10. Role of legislative environment for power systems 11. Power source support in outstanding market environment. 12. Function of interconnected power networks in market conditions 13. Demand side management.
